What is the difference between Commission Inbound Insurance Sales vs Insurance Agent?

FeatureCommission Inbound Insurance SalesInsurance Agent
CredentialsLicensing required, insurance-specific certificationsLicensing required, insurance-specific certifications
Work EnvironmentCall centers, remote, or office-basedIndependent or agency offices, remote or in-person
Employer & Industry UsageInsurance companies, brokeragesInsurance agencies, brokerages
Sales ApproachInbound calls, customer inquiriesOutbound and inbound sales, client meetings

Commission Inbound Insurance Sales primarily involves handling incoming customer inquiries via calls or online channels, focusing on inbound leads. Insurance Agents may engage in both inbound and outbound sales, often working directly with clients in person or remotely. Both roles require licensing and insurance certifications, but their work environments and sales methods differ.

Insurance Agent Job Summary:

Texas Farm Bureau Insurance is seeking an insurance agent to join our growing team. The primary responsibility of this insurance sales role is specific to the generation of new clients for our insurance products and services. Specifically, you would serve an existing client base and generate new prospective clients to help them understand our full scope of products and services.

Insurance Agent Responsibilities:

  • Marketing and lead generation
  • Qualification of prospective leads
  • Initial prospect contact 
  • Building client files
  • Creating insurance sales presentations and proposals 
  • Identifying cross sell opportunities 
  • Successfully executing a pre-determined number of insurance sales calls
  • Completing full fact-finding interviews on prospective and existing clients 
  • Shadowing and participating in calls, visits, and presentations 
  • Successfully signing new clients and products to obtain quotas

Insurance Agent Qualifications: 

  • College Degree Preferred
  • Goal and action oriented, with ability and desire to work towards activity and sales targets
  • High level of comfort with outreach directly to prospective clients 
  • Strong verbal and written communication skills, with the ability to engage one-on-one as well as to an audience. 
  • Persistence, drive and ability to work proactively
  • Team player and team spirited
